Responsibilities
- Set up, run, and monitor automated manufacturing machinery to meet daily production goals.
- Conduct regular quality checks using precision measuring tools and visual inspections.
- Identify minor equipment issues and perform light mechanical adjustments to prevent downtime.
- Follow OHSA guidelines, keeping workstations clean, safe, and organized.
- Collaborate with production team members to maintain optimal workflow across the plant.

Qualifications
- Experience: Previous work history in manufacturing, warehouse, or industrial facility settings.
- Mechanical Skill: Comfortable operating machinery and utilizing basic hand tools.
- Reliability: Proven record of consistent attendance, punctuality, and strong work ethic.
- Safety First: Committed to maintaining a safe work culture for all team members.
- Physical Capability: Ability to handle physical tasks and stay active throughout your shift.
